Li Junzheng
Born in 1991 in Dazhou, Sichuan.
Graduated with a Bachelor's degree from Sichuan Fine Arts Institute in 2015.
Graduated with a Master's degree from Sichuan Fine Arts Institute in 2018.
Member of the China Artists Association and Director of the Chongqing Oil Painting Society.
Primarily engaged in painting and installation art creation.
A professional artist, currently residing in Chongqing.
Creative Inspiration
Young artist Li Junzheng, a graduate of the Oil Painting Department of Sichuan Fine Arts Institute, creates artworks characterized by vivid and profound colors, akin to the different sections of a symphony, each independent yet harmoniously resonating together. In his creative process, Li skillfully applies the visual principles of color field painting, boldly breaking free from the constraints of traditional color, pushing the tension and rhythm of color to its extreme. This results in visual impact and artistic shock. His works often use basic materials such as wood panels, acrylic paint, and utility knives, combining manual strength and delicate lines to construct a contrast between space and abstraction, aiming to explore the essence of art and the self. With meticulous brushstrokes, he captures nature’s fleeting moments, transforming the forms of mountains, rivers, and plants into reflections of the soul. Notably, the layering and shifting of hues in the wood panel, coupled with dynamic changes in tone and form, allows viewers to experience not only the visual beauty of the work but also a sense of the vastness of the universe and the rhythm of life.
Li’s creative language also reflects a philosophical meditation on nature, built through time, materials, and rational actions, generating works with depth and layers. Every stroke and line in his work carries the traces of time and the memory of materials, interwoven to form a unique visual effect. This act of "creation" starting from the act of painting is, in fact, a concrete expression of his understanding of natural laws and the universe. For instance, in his series "The Paradox of the Line's Memory," he begins with a random line and continues to arrange subsequent lines along the path of the previous one, attempting to find the memory of the line. During this repetitive process, various variables and uncontrollable factors alter the trajectory of new lines, making the search for the line's memory a paradox. The concept and Li’s ongoing act of painting automatically generate changes and rhythm in the images within the work. Expanding from this series, he has further explored new concepts and materials, such as in his "Blue" series, which experiments with new materials, and his "Untitled" and "Cortex" series, which explore spatial dimensions. In these explorations, he seeks to understand the potential for space, time, and conceptual intervention in painting. Exhibition Experience
2024年「山悦和光」李军政个展,千雪里美画廊,上海
2024年 「格物致」李军政个展,勒木画廊,北京
2023年 「叠见」李军政个展,发酵艺术中心,沈阳
2023年 「皮层」李军政立体油画创作展,
KAI’S GALLERY,台北
2023年 「物性生成」李军政个展,锦瑟画廊,重庆
2022年 李军政油画作品分享会,居山艺术空间
2021年 「皮层2021」李军政个展,T2国际当代艺术中心,重庆
2020年 「居山」李军政油画作品展,新空艺术空间
2019年 「李军政个展」四川美术学院微企园川上
2016年 「精神返乡」李军政油画作品展,X画廊
2015年 「生息」李军政油画作品展,X画廊
获奖经历
2019年 作品《关于线的记忆性的悖论4》入选第十三届全国美展综合材料展区;
2019年 中国黄山(黟县)青年写生艺术季 · 青年写生大展,获铜奖;
2019年 第三届独立品格提名展,获“优秀奖”,大河湾美术馆,北京;
2018年 「在地与间离」首届重庆油画双年展,获“评委提名奖”,重庆美术馆;
2018年 「好在凤凰春未晚」全国优秀写生作品展,获“一等奖”,湖南;
2018年 作品《关于线的记忆性的悖论4》获第六届全国青年美展优秀奖(最高奖),并获第十三届全国美展展区直送作品资格,中国美术馆,北京;
2018年 获四川美术学院优秀毕业研究生;
2018年 获研究生国家奖学金;
2018年 第四届“学院的精神•天道”——八大美术学院研究生优秀作品展获 “二等奖”;
2017年 inter-youth国际青年绘画展,获“创作奖”,中国美术学院美术馆;杭州
2016年 四川美术学院第13届研究生年展,获优秀作品奖,虎溪公社 重庆;
2015年 2015国际时尚艺术大奖暨跨界展,今日美术馆,北京;
2015年 “凯撒艺术新星”2015大学生提名展,获“最佳表达奖”,今日美术馆, 北京;
2015年 获四川美术学院eland优秀创作奖学金;
2015年 作品入选四川美术学院油画系学生作品年展,获“油画系文献库提名奖”;
